Montana Radio: Iliad Media To Acquire Nine Stations


Iliad Media Group Holdings has acquired nine radio stations in the Helena, Montana region through the purchase of Montana Radio Company. The acquired stations, located in Montana’s capital city area, offer a variety of formats including country, rock, pop, and news.

Iliad, which transitioned to employee ownership via an employee stock ownership plan (ESOP) in 2022, will integrate Montana Radio Company employees into the ESOP, expanding its roster of employee-owners. 

CEO Darrell Calton expressed enthusiasm about the acquisition, stating, “We are thrilled to bring The Montana Radio Company into the Iliad family. Our mutual commitment to employee ownership and community-oriented broadcasting sets the stage for a vibrant fusion of radio cultures.”

Montana Radio Company’s CEO and Founding Owner, Kevin Terry, echoed this sentiment: “Partnering with Iliad Media Group is a natural fit with our goal of building a workplace where employees share in the company’s achievements. This transition secures both stability and a sense of ownership for our Montana team.”

The Montana stations will retain their current leadership and branding. Notably, the Nampa-based Joey & Lauren morning show, syndicated regionally by Iliad via My 102.7, is already broadcast on Helena’s Mix 102.3.

Terry founded Montana Radio Company in 2011 with a single country station and one employee. Over the years, it expanded to nine stations and over 30 staff members. In 2017, the company engaged in a complex transaction with another firm, further boosting its presence in the Helena market.

Following this acquisition, Iliad now controls 23 stations across the Boise, Twin Falls, and Helena markets.
